...RED FLAG WARNING IN EFFECT UNTIL 8 PM MDT THIS EVENING...

.DISCUSSION...

Slight chance of a thunderstorm early this evening, otherwise continued
very warm and dry. No significant winds expected, but afternoon breezes
southwest 10 to 15 mph will develop each day through Monday. Poor overnight
humidity recovery for next several nights.
